Wages clarified

To the editor:

I feel the need to set something straight about the article on the minimum wage increase. I believe that Rudy’s Pizzeria was not given a fair shake. Everyone who works there makes a base pay, but also makes commissions and tips. The end result is a wage that is two to three times that of minimum wage and far above what is considered a living wage. People who work at Rudy’s do so for years because they do get paid well and are treated with much respect. On top of treating its employees well, Rudy’s donates to almost every local organization that asks for help, including churches, schools, charities and more. For 16 years this locally grown business has done right by its employees and the community and deserves to have the record set straight.
